Miley Cyrus performed her emotion-filled song “Slide Away” for a live debut of the song since it’s released which came just five days after Cyrus and Liam Hemsworth announced their separation, which days later Hemsworth filed for divorce from the pop superstar. The performance also marks Cyrus’ first live appearance since the couple’s separation. This performance marked Cyrus’ third time on stage at the MTV VMAs, most recently hosting the show in 2015.
Cyrus was announced as a surprise addition to the album star-studded Video Music Awards performance lineup this morning, just hours ahead of the performance. The performance took place tonight (Aug. 26) onstage at Prudential Center in Newark, NJ.
Cyrus’ performance of “Slide Away” was a tear-jerking performance that was in black and white as Cyrus’ performed in her black mini skirt with a backing band and orchestra behind her. Starting the performance as a silhouette before stepping into the spotlight to sing the song about her unfortunate divorce that Cyrus is coping with through music and song with this fierce new emotion-filled song that we can see will soon become a radio hit. Ending her performance with a massive standing ovation which also seen her mom Tish and dad Billy standing to support their daughter.
